Connecting with Local Communities via Language Programs in English

Connecting with local communities through language programs in English provides a unique pathway for cultural exchange, mutual understanding, and shared growth. These programs serve as bridges, enabling people from diverse backgrounds to break down barriers, appreciate one another’s cultures, and foster meaningful connections. By leveraging the universal reach of the English language, participants can engage in dynamic dialogues, cooperative projects, and enriching experiences that benefit both individuals and the communities they join. Whether you’re a visitor, immigrant, or longtime resident, engaging in language programs opens doors to new relationships and deepens your connection to the place you call home.

Benefits of Language Programs for Communities

Enhancing Cross-Cultural Collaboration

Effective communication is the bedrock of successful collaboration. English language programs create opportunities for people from different backgrounds to work together on community projects, whether in schools, environmental initiatives, or neighborhood improvement campaigns. This shared effort nurtures mutual understanding, harnessing the unique strengths that each participant brings. Over time, these collaborative experiences build lasting networks that can mobilize swiftly to address community priorities, share resources, and celebrate multicultural achievements, thereby reinforcing social bonds and collective responsibility.

Promoting Educational Opportunities

Language programs serve as gateways to educational advancement for learners of all ages. Mastering English opens the door to local educational institutions, professional training, and lifelong learning opportunities. Community-based English programs often tailor their curriculum to meet local needs, from vocational language skills to supporting academic achievement in schools. As participants gain language competency, they are better equipped to pursue higher education, access job markets, and participate in skills-based workshops that improve their prospects and contribute positively to the community’s socio-economic development.

Fostering Volunteerism and Civic Engagement

Communities thrive when their members are actively involved in civic life. English language programs often incorporate components of civic education, teaching not just language skills but also the norms, values, and structures underlying community participation. As learners gain confidence in their communication skills, they are more likely to volunteer for local causes, attend public meetings, and even run for local office. This increased involvement brings new voices and ideas into the public sphere, refreshing community leadership and ensuring that local initiatives reflect the diversity and aspirations of all residents.

Designing Effective Language Programs

A powerful English language program begins with a thorough understanding of the community’s makeup and aspirations. Program coordinators engage with local leaders, educators, and residents to assess language proficiency levels, preferred learning styles, and specific communication challenges. By tailoring content and delivery methods accordingly, programs maximize accessibility and relevance. This sensitivity ensures greater participant motivation and engagement while also allowing the program to address broader community goals, such as economic development or social integration, in meaningful ways.
